Fustet (medicine)


fustet


The wood of the Rhus Cptinus or Venice sumach, a shrub of Southern Europe, which yields a fine orange colour, which, however, is not durable without a mordant.

Origin: F. Fustet (cf. Sp. & Pg. Fustete), LL. Fustetus, fr. L. Fustis stick, in LL, tree, See 1st Fust, and cf. Fustic.
